Legal Rights
Legal rights are rights accorded to individuals by law, including civil liberties and entitlements protected by the constitution or the legislation of the jurisdiction in which they reside.
Social Inclusion
The process of improving the terms of participation in society for people who are disadvantaged, through enhanced opportunities, access to resources, voice, and respect for rights.
Canadian Charter
A foundational document of Canada's Constitution, officially known as the Canadian Charter of Rights and Freedoms, which outlines the rights and freedoms of Canadian citizens.
